(Column 6/12) (copy) (Column 6/12) (copy) Who We Are/About Us * Visual Text The A.R.K. is one of the largest free-standing wildlife rehabilitation facilities in Michigan. In 2024, A.R.K. admitted almost 1500 injured and orphaned wildlife. In addition to rehabilitation, A.R.K. offers a paid summer internship to give university students interested in pursuing a wildlife or veterinary degree hands-on experience working with wildlife. We also hold state and federal permits to keep unreleasable raptors and mammals for use in education programs at schools and other venues. (Column 6/12) (copy) (copy) (Column 6/12) (copy) (copy) How You Help Visual Text A.R.K. is always looking for hardworking volunteers who love animals and can abide by established protocols. We ask volunteers to sign up for at least one 4 hr shift per week. Training is provided and there are several areas where we need help including animal care and education programs.
